Breastfeeding twins can be more of a hassle than breastfeeding a single baby as you will need to pump enough to feed two mouths. Breast pumps for twins help you feed your babies, and saves you pumping time.

Hospital-grade pumps come highly recommended, especially if your baby is born early, and you have issues producing milk. Hospital-grade breast pumps help stimulate breastmilk production and reduce pumping time.

How long should I pump for twins?

You should pump for about 15 to 20 minutes every pumping session, and make sure you fully drain each breast. Keep an eye out for their needs and how much they consume as they grow, and adjust how you pump accordingly.

How do I pump enough breast milk for twins?

Are you worried that you may not produce enough milk for your twins? Or maybe you have a low supply of breast milk. Follow these tips on how to pump enough for twins.

  • Let your babies nurse very often as it will cause your body to adjust to demand at any time.
  • You can try lactation supplements to boost the production of breast milk.
  • Power pump for three days straight, and make sure your breasts are empty. It makes your body produce more breast milk
  • Eat and drink enough
  • Get ample rest. A well-rested and well-fed body will produce more milk, and make it easier to pump
  • Massage your breasts when you pump or nurse to stimulate more milk production
  • If you still don’t produce enough milk, you should see a lactation consultant

The guaranteed way to have enough milk for babies is to nurse and pump.

Can you exclusively pump for twins?

Yes, you can pump exclusively for your twins. If you want to pump solely, there are a few things you need to know to be prepared.

As a mother of twins, you will need help, so you should accept any help you get. Ensure your diet is balanced as you may need to pump as much as ten times every day, and it may be more depending on how much your twins consume.

You may want to prepare to pump about 27 oz of breast milk postpartum. Get suitable breast pumps, and you should go for the most comfortable ones. It is recommended that you opt for hospital-grade breast pumps. You must get adequate rest, so relax at every opportunity you get.

Do you produce more milk with twins?

A nursing woman will usually produce enough breast milk to feed twins. Milk production is largely dependent on the amount of milk your babies take. Regardless of the number of babies you have to feed, your body will produce enough to feed them; however, make sure you consume the right diet to cater to your babies’ needs.

If you are having trouble with pumping, you can try relaxing, or kangaroo care to aid with output. Stay away from medication that affects the hormones.
